0

我正在为我的整个 Dao 类使用 @Transactional 注释,并使用 spring 和 hibernate。一切都很好,只是我想在我的 Dao 中省略一些与数据库无关的方法的行为。

http://static.springsource.org/spring/docs/2.5.4/reference/transaction.html#transaction-declarative-annotations

每次我在调试会话期间进入这些方法时,我总是会遇到非常烦人的 JdkDynamicAopProxy.class。

有什么方法可以省略特定方法的事务性?或者至少修复这个烦人的调试行为?

4

1 回答 1

1

在 Spring 中,您可以@Transactional仅将注释放在您想要进行事务处理的方法上,而不是将其放在类级别。

否则也许考虑将那些特定的非事务性方法提取到一个单独的类中?

于 2013-04-03T10:32:41.127 回答